    IMPORTANT:
    If you are using only the official patches you need to install the interface for DW5.1 or the mod will crash.
    As the launcher only changes the true MEIOU-mod you need to rename the TECC-directory to MEIOU, update the interface, and rename it to TECC
    That'll solve the crash.

    Update log:

    Towards 0.16.9a
    ---------------
    - Took out TECC specific decisions (aTECC.txt) as they caused a CTD on startup

    Towards 0.16.8a
    ---------------
    - All of MJPoland's work added
    - updated to most recent MEIOU-version, including many bugfixes
    - changed the techlevels (now they go up to 135): this is experimental for now as the new techlevels don't do anything yet. Main idea is to test tech-costs.

    Towards 0.16.5a
    ---------------
    - added MJpoland's work: many new nations, flags, history
    - some updates to the 1050 religion-map (bogomils -gnostic- are now on the map in Bosnia)
    - Bosnia has gnosic as state religion at the end of the 12th century.
    - Several provinces in the Near East and Armenian regions changed to Oriental Christian (Armenian Church doesn't fall under the Orthodox Group)
    - 'Independence' of a number of nations in the HRE brought forward to increase starting options.

    Towards 0.16.1a
    ---------------
    - rectified several province-files in order to solve a CTD-issue

    Towards 0.16a
    ---------------
    - added new nation in Anatolia: Danishmend
    - added several new nations in HRE for more OPM-fun!
    - reworked several stemduchies: Upper and Lower Lorraine, Franconia, Swabia (many changes only visible in post-1090 start)
    - some additional work on Italy
    - some work on France, the Alençon-Normandy issue remains unresolved.
    - some minor changes in the near-east and pontic steppes
    - changed the Berg-Julich establishment decision to allow Mark in on the fun.
    - updated to MEIOU:TD 5.5 and corrected some legacies (due to new provinces)

    Towards 0.15a
    ---------------
    - added events and decision that enables a certain William to conquer England in 1 fell swoop
    - added an event (seems to work, not sure) that enables culture shift from anglosaxon to anglois
    - added anglosaxon culture
    - replaced the Anglosaxon Empire with England at gamestart. Is a bit better
    - changed the name of normandy to normandy (was Alençon), changed flag to proper. (is potential placeholder given info on Alençon-issue)
    - added an event to enables a certain Harald to conquer England in 1 fell swoop
    - changed the decision that forms the North Sea Empire to take anglosaxon culture into account, added some more provinces that it needs to control in England and Norway
    - added event&decision descriptions
    - some small changes to provinces and nations
    - changed some techs.

    Towards 0.14a
    -------------
    - Updated to MEIOU TD 5.4.3
    - Updated province-ownership in the Old World for the 1050 start
    - Updated rulers -when data is available- in the Old World for the 1050 start
    - Updated HRE borders for 1050 start
    - Updated Electors for 1050 start
    - Updated religion-map for 1050 start

    Towards 0.12a
    -------------
    - updated TECC to the latest version of MEIOU

    Towards 0.11a:
    --------------
    - updated technology files for a 1050 start

    Towards 0.10a:
    --------------
    - General update to the current version of MEIOU
    - some big changes in India (some new states there)
    - ad hoc updates of provinces with numbers higher than 2553 (Nicaea)

    Towards 0.9a:
    -------------
    - updated Asia Minor and Levant to fit the period 1050-1356
    - HRE-fix for 1050 by NovaCameron
    - Several new states to play with (Ilkhanate, Gengis' Empire, Khwarezmid Empire) but none of them are really finished.
    - started work on Iraq and Arab peninsula.
    - some smaller fixes for the Crusaderstates.

    Well, Fuzzbug and i mainly communicate by this forum and by mail. Same with Solo_Adhémar for the graphics.
    I'd say the main issue is to track the modifications done and not forget to put all the files other modders send you in... and believe me, it happens... right Fuzzbug ?

    But of course, Fuzzbug, Solo and i seldom work on the same files at same time. If you are to work on same file, an instant messenging tool like messenger or skype or whatever could be usefull.
